JEE Math Practice Question

Let $$y=y(x)$$ be the solution of the differential equation $$\left(1+x^2\right) \frac{d y}{d x}+y=e^{\tan ^{-1} x}$$, $$y(1)=0$$. Then $$y(0)$$ is

  1. A.$$\frac{1}{4}\left(e^{\pi / 2}-1\right)$$
  2. B.$$\frac{1}{2}\left(1-e^{\pi / 2}\right)$$
  3. C.$$\frac{1}{4}\left(1-e^{\pi / 2}\right)$$
  4. D.$$\frac{1}{2}\left(e^{\pi / 2}-1\right)$$
